Transaction 592aecc84303f8233d69dc6ec0d47ee93ae6ecb6e9cdd0fda00646a75cd1baef
1 Input
1 Output
-
592aecc84303f8233d69dc6ec0d47ee93ae6ecb6e9cdd0fda00646a75cd1baef:0
- value
- 4680476
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56d60322bd6517ebb626f30ec7632b152177c794 OP_EQUAL
- address
- 39cAQsahrm7hqYjQziowUAnjABf5h63x5F